3-5 Technical/Software Skills:
Install various parts and assemblies such as landing gear, aircraft control surfaces, exterior panels, carpets, blankets, roller trays/ball mats, stowbins, sidewalls, ceiling panels, lavatories, galleys, doors, and seats.
Install various aircraft system components such as tubing, valves, regulators, actuators, compressors, and ducts.
Use various hand tools and diagnostic equipment such as screwdrivers, ratchets, power screwdriver multi meters, continuity testers.
